My Son who drives my 87 ttop as his daily driver has always wanted a 3800sc 5 speed. He works fulltime at Auto Zone has been saving his money to one day get and or build one. Well Yesterday we picked up a 3800cs 5 speed that was complete and just needs paint and some frontend work. I drove it home for him. It was an 80 mile trip and it ran great. Just a loose frontend. The car swap is done very well/ The motor only has 10,000 miles on it. It is freshly rebuilt. It has coil overs in the rear and a 3.4 zzp pully on it. It came with a whole bunch of paperwork. on the costs to get it where it is now. So the plan is to part it till after winter and start on it one section at a time.

In my opinion, the 10.5mm plug wires are not very good.
I had a set and one of the wire boots melted! Another one started to short out when hot.
The size of these wires makes them prone to be too close to the exhaust manifolds.

I went back to stock style wires from RockAuto - not even an expensive set!
And because you can bend these wires up and away from the manifold quickly, they don't get as near to the hot parts.
Since then I've had no ignition problems.
